Idaho Springs Colorado Real Estate Market Overview
Understanding market dynamics is crucial when considering a purchase in Idaho Springs. Here’s a current snapshot based on verified data for 2024 from the Clear Creek County Assessor and Colorado Association of Realtors:
- Median Home Price: $550,000 (noting a 5% increase year over year)
- Home Price Range: $350,000 for small cabins/condos to over $1 million for large mountain estates
- Average Days on Market: Approximately 40-60 days indicating moderate buyer activity
- Inventory: Limited supply with mixed opportunities in historic homes, newer construction, and vacant land
- Land For Sale: Parcels typically range from 0.5 acres to 5+ acres, popular for custom builds and retreats

Comparing Idaho Springs to Nearby Mountain Communities
| Community | Median Home Price | Proximity to Denver | Vibe | Typical Property Types |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Idaho Springs | $550,000 | ~30 miles | Historic mountain town | Cabins, estates, land |
| Evergreen | $800,000+ | ~20 miles | Upscale mountain lifestyle | Luxury homes, ranches |
| Golden | $600,000 | ~15 miles | Historic city with suburban feel | Older homes, new builds |

How close is Idaho Springs to Denver?
Idaho Springs is approximately 30 miles west of Denver via I-70, easily accessible for commuters or weekenders.
